vAirpower/macos-office365-mcp-server

A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for automating Microsoft Office 365 applications (PowerPoint and Word) on macOS through AI agents like Claude and Cline.

This tool allows AI assistants like Claude or Cline to directly create and edit Microsoft Office documents on your macOS computer. You can use natural language commands to generate presentations, reports, or spreadsheets. It takes your instructions as input and outputs fully formatted PowerPoint, Word, or Excel files, ideal for anyone who regularly drafts documents and wants to automate repetitive content creation with AI.

No commits in the last 6 months.

Use this if you want your AI assistant to directly control Microsoft Office applications on your Mac to generate and modify documents, presentations, and spreadsheets without manual intervention.

Not ideal if you need a cloud-based Office automation solution or if you don't use AI assistants that support the Model Context Protocol (MCP).
